Kojic soap is a type of soap that contains kojic acid as the main active ingredient. Kojic acid is a natural compound that is derived from various fungi, and it has been shown to have skin-lightening and anti-aging effects.
Here are some potential benefits of using kojic soap:
Reducing the appearance of hyperpigmentation: Kojic acid has been shown to help reduce the appearance of hyperpigmentation on the skin, including age spots, melasma, and sun damage.
Brightening the skin: Kojic acid can also help to brighten the skin and improve its overall appearance, giving it a more youthful and radiant look.
Exfoliating the skin: Kojic soap can also help to exfoliate the skin, removing dead skin cells and impurities that can clog pores and contribute to dull, uneven skin texture.
Fighting acne and blemishes: Kojic soap has also been shown to have antibacterial properties, which can help to fight acne-causing bacteria and reduce the occurrence of breakouts and blemishes.
Overall, kojic soap can be a helpful addition to a skincare routine for those looking to improve the appearance and texture of their skin, particularly for those with hyperpigmentation, uneven skin tone, or acne-prone skin.
However, it is important to note that kojic acid can be irritating to some skin types, and it is best to start with a patch test and use the soap in moderation to avoid any adverse reactions.
